James, Marquette aim for fifth straight win

Jan 24, 2007 - 2:44 PM Seton Hall (11-7) at No. 20 Marquette (17-4) 8:00 pm EST

MILWAUKEE (Ticker) -- Dominic James and Marquette proved they can beat Pittsburgh. Now they just have to keep pace with the Big East Conference's top squad.

James and the 20th-ranked Golden Eagles look for their fifth straight win Wednesday when they host Seton Hall in Big East play.

One of the top point guards in the country, James was the hero in Marquette's thrilling 77-74 overtime upset at then sixth-ranked Pittsburgh on Sunday. The sophomore scored 23 points and drilled a pair of go-ahead free throws with one second remaining in the extra session.

With the win, the Golden Eagles (17-4, 4-2 Big East) climbed within one game of the first-place Panthers (17-3, 5-1).

Marquette's leading scorer, James has been averaging 20.7 points over his last three games. He aims to help the Golden Eagles extend their four-game winning streak against a Seton Hall (11-7, 3-3) squad which hopes to bounce back from Friday's 74-58 loss to Georgetown.

Brian Laing scored 19 points to pace the Pirates, who have alternated wins and losses over their last 11 games.

Marquette won the only meeting between the schools last season, a 67-63 triumph in East Rutherford.
